Right, so now Iβm in front of my computer, I guess I will write some more about my diet.
I ate very little red meat, the protein part of my diet is mostly chicken breast (for much reduced haem content). I eat quite a lot of eggs, which in addition to the protein in egg white, is also a good source for fat.Over the years I become rather creative in seasoning, which is the key to make keto diet tolerable long term.
The bulk of my food intake by volume is vegetables, like cabbage, broccoli, spinach etc.
I still occasionally consume high carb food, but as I age, it become increasingly more difficult to get back into ketosis, I just need more and more time in induction phase.
